Corporations Act 2001

CHAPTER 5D - LICENSED TRUSTEE COMPANIES  

PART 5D.3 - REGULATION OF FEES CHARGED BY LICENSED TRUSTEE COMPANIES  

Division 2 - General provisions about charging fees  

SECTION 601TBE   ESTATE MANAGEMENT FUNCTIONS: PAYMENT OF FEES OUT OF ESTATE  

601TBE(1)   [ Application]  

This section applies to the performance by a licensed trustee company of an estate management function relating to a particular estate.

601TBE(2)   [ Fees payable out of capital or income of estate]  

Subject to subsection (3), fees charged by the trustee company, in accordance with this Part, for the performance of the function are payable to the trustee company out of the capital or income of the relevant estate.

601TBE(3)   [ Exceptions]  

Unless ASIC approves it under subsection (4):


(a) a management fee referred to in section 601TDD can only come out of the income of the relevant estate; and


(b) a common fund administration fee referred to in section 601TDE or 601TDI can only come out of the income received by the common fund on the assets of the charitable trust concerned that are included in the fund.

601TBE(4)    


ASIC may, on application in writing by a licensed trustee company, approve payment of a proposed fee that, if paid without the approval, would contravene subsection (3), if ASIC is satisfied that:


(a) the payment of the fee will not significantly affect the capital of the relevant estate or charitable trust concerned; and


(b) the fee is a fair reflection of the work and expertise required to perform the estate management function.
